I am trying to resolve the build issue with the latest Mesa in X11:XOrg. I
used upstream patches to make it work with the latest llvm, but somehow it is
now failing as that llvm-config --libs returns non-existing libraries. This
causes errors during the link-phase.
I will try to contact cartman to see how we can resolve this. Strangely enough
when I build the Mesa package directly against Factory/snapshot, then it
builds. But for the target X11:XOrg, I get the mentioned links errors.
